基于J2EE的銀行招聘信息系統(tǒng)設(shè)計(jì)與實(shí)現(xiàn)
本文選題:銀行招聘 + 信息系統(tǒng); 參考:《天津大學(xué)》2016年碩士論文
【摘要】:商業(yè)銀行屬于知識(shí)密集型行業(yè),專業(yè)人才對(duì)于銀行的發(fā)展具有至關(guān)重要的作用。將軟件系統(tǒng)應(yīng)用到銀行招聘工作中,能夠提升招聘業(yè)務(wù)的信息化水平。本文以某商業(yè)銀行為研究對(duì)象,設(shè)計(jì)開發(fā)銀行招聘信息系統(tǒng),為銀行招聘工作提供信息化辦公平臺(tái)。信息系統(tǒng)選擇以RUP模型作為生命周期,將系統(tǒng)的開發(fā)劃分為若干時(shí)間階段,在每一個(gè)時(shí)間階段中通過若干工作流的循環(huán)完成對(duì)應(yīng)階段目標(biāo)實(shí)現(xiàn)。以Web體系結(jié)構(gòu)作為系統(tǒng)的組織架構(gòu)形式,J2EE作為系統(tǒng)的開發(fā)平臺(tái)。全面調(diào)研了招聘信息系統(tǒng)的使用者類型,把系統(tǒng)使用者劃分成為多種參與者。以UML用例圖構(gòu)建了對(duì)于各種參與者功能需求的圖形化描述模型。分析了招聘業(yè)務(wù)中若干業(yè)務(wù)的執(zhí)行過程,構(gòu)建了業(yè)物流圖與數(shù)據(jù)流圖,實(shí)現(xiàn)對(duì)于業(yè)務(wù)流程的建模。將本項(xiàng)目劃分成為View、Logic、DAL的三層結(jié)構(gòu)體系。View層是應(yīng)用程序客戶端構(gòu)建層,其用于創(chuàng)建客戶端交互界面。Logic層具有應(yīng)用程序邏輯處理的作用,其具有若干業(yè)務(wù)邏輯類與方法,分別響應(yīng)客戶端的各種請(qǐng)求。DAL層是應(yīng)用程序的數(shù)據(jù)訪問管理層,通過該層次中的數(shù)據(jù)訪問類,實(shí)現(xiàn)對(duì)于各個(gè)數(shù)據(jù)庫表的讀寫。把軟件系統(tǒng)劃分成為四個(gè)功能模塊,包括系統(tǒng)運(yùn)維模塊、職位管理模塊、招聘管理模塊和錄用管理模塊。設(shè)計(jì)了每一個(gè)功能模塊的數(shù)據(jù)庫ER模型,綜合得的數(shù)據(jù)庫的總體ER模型,并將轉(zhuǎn)換形成了數(shù)據(jù)庫關(guān)系模型。按照功能模塊劃分,實(shí)現(xiàn)了各個(gè)功能模塊的詳細(xì)設(shè)計(jì)。根據(jù)系統(tǒng)的設(shè)計(jì)模型,完成了系統(tǒng)的開發(fā)與測試。銀行招聘信息系統(tǒng)能夠滿足用戶在招聘業(yè)務(wù)中的各項(xiàng)業(yè)務(wù)處理需求,系統(tǒng)運(yùn)行穩(wěn)定,提升了招聘工作的信息化程度。
[Abstract]:The commercial bank belongs to the knowledge-intensive industry, the specialized personnel has the vital function to the bank development. The application of software system to bank recruitment can improve the information level of recruitment business. This paper takes a commercial bank as the research object, designs and develops the bank recruitment information system, provides the information office platform for the bank recruitment work. The Rup model is chosen as the life cycle of the information system. The development of the system is divided into several time stages. Web architecture is taken as the organizational structure of the system and J2EE is used as the development platform of the system. The user types of the recruitment information system are investigated, and the system users are divided into a variety of participants. The UML use case diagram is used to construct a graphical description model for the functional requirements of various participants. This paper analyzes the execution process of some business in the recruitment business, constructs the industry logistics diagram and the data flow diagram, and realizes the modeling of the business process. This project is divided into three layers structure system. View layer is the client building layer of application program, which is used to create client interface. Logic layer has the function of application logic processing, and it has several business logic classes and methods. In response to various requests from the client, the Dal layer is the data access management layer of the application program. Through the data access classes in this layer, the database tables can be read and written. The software system is divided into four functional modules, including system operation and maintenance module, position management module, recruitment management module and employment management module. The database ER model of each function module is designed, the overall ER model of the database is synthesized, and the database relational model is transformed into a database relational model. According to the functional module division, the detailed design of each functional module is realized. According to the design model of the system, the development and test of the system are completed. The bank recruitment information system can meet the needs of the users in the recruitment business, the system runs stably, and improves the information level of the recruitment work.
